| Product(s) Recalled: | Ready-to-eat cooked "Weisswurst" sausage, individually packaged in approximately 1 pound packages as purchased at retail store. |
|---|---|
| Production Dates/Identifying Codes: | "Weisswurst" and the actual date of sale (from May 18, 1999, through May 25, 1999). |
| Problem/Reason for Recall: | The product may be contaminated with Listeria monocytogenes |
| How/When Discovered: | Through the routine FSIS monitoring program. The sample tested positive for Listeria monocytogenes on May 28, 1999. |
| Establishment: | Establishment 05057 M The Alpine Wurst & Meat House RD #4 - Box 155 - Route 6 Honesdale, PA 18431 |
| Corporate Contact: | Mr. Mark Eiferst, Vice President, (570-253-5899) |
| Quantity Recalled: | Approximately 60 pounds. |
| Distribution: | Honesdale, Pennsylvania (northeastern) |
| Recall Classification: | Class I |
| Recall Notification Level: | To the consumer level, retail sale. |
| Press Release: | Yes |
| Direct Notification Means: | The company is contacting its customers by telephone. |
| FSIS Followup Activities: | District Enforcement will conduct effectiveness checks. |
| Other Agencies Involved: | None |
